In a whirlwind of political drama, Robert F. Kennedy Jr. appears set to drop out of the presidential race, aiming to lend support to Donald Trump’s quest for the White House. Scheduled to deliver a pivotal speech in Phoenix, Arizona this Friday, Kennedy is taking the stage to clarify his ‘path forward’—a phrase that has both curious voters and political analysts on the edge of their seats. With his campaign losing steam and financial backing, it seems like the end of a chapter for the independent candidate who has shaken things up more than a caffeinated squirrel at a sunflower festival.

Meanwhile, Republican Senator JD Vance recently chimed in, claiming that Trump is keenly pursuing Kennedy’s endorsement. It seems this political tango is not just a one-man show. With voices like Nicole Shanahan, RFK Jr.’s running mate, suggesting that JFK’s descendant might indeed back the former president, the plot thickens faster than grandma’s secret gravy recipe on Thanksgiving.

In the grand schema of U.S. elections, independent candidates often face an uphill battle. Historically, they have influenced major party dynamics, dragging attention to key issues that might otherwise be brushed under the rug. For instance, the influence of Ross Perot in the 1992 election, who arguably paved the way for Bill Clinton's victory, suggests that every candidate, no matter how briefly they flicker in the spotlight, adds a new layer of complexity to the electoral tapestry.
